Output 80260aa0da2a3e83d0b23f40ba30e46621450b6eb9284e5fa592d1662442bee0:5

value
2581216
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b2f7928886063a07a8ee94c99b95656d0e26e6a OP_EQUALVERIFY OP_CHECKSIG
address
16PwjpVwu7jYUKA6f6CioYDATmg4wK38dx
transaction
80260aa0da2a3e83d0b23f40ba30e46621450b6eb9284e5fa592d1662442bee0
spent
true